Safety First: Protecting Your Hands
Pest control isn't just about catching critters; it also involves handling chemicals and potential biohazards. For instance, while applying insecticides or dealing with debris from a pest-infested area, it's essential to protect your skin from these harsh substances. Flexible latex gloves act as a barrier between your hands and dangerous materials.

Choosing the Right Flexible Latex Gloves
When selecting the perfect pair of flexible latex gloves, here are a few tips based on my own experiences:1. Size Matters: Ensure the gloves fit snugly but aren't too tight. You should have enough room to wiggle your fingers, enabling complete control.2. Check for Thickness: While you want flexibility, a slightly thicker glove can offer more protection without losing sensitivity.3. Powdered vs. Powder-Free: Some prefer powdered gloves for easier donning, while others, like me, appreciate the comfort of powder-free options to avoid any residue.4. Disposable or Reusable: For most pest control tasks, I recommend disposable gloves for high-risk situations. However, if you're performing light duties around the house, a durable reusable option could suffice.
